Tire Flip Exercise Description

The tire flip is a strongman-style, total-body compound lift that blends a powerful hip and knee extension with a forward push. Primary drivers are the glutes, hamstrings, and quadriceps, with the calves assisting and the spinal erectors, lats, and core bracing to maintain a neutral spine. As the tire rises, the chest and shoulders contribute during the push phase, while the forearms and hands handle the demanding grip. The movement pattern starts like a deadlift/hip hinge and transitions into a controlled shove as the tire nears vertical. Proper execution emphasizes keeping the tire close, leading with leg and hip drive (not the arms), and maintaining spinal alignment throughout. Performed with sound mechanics, the tire flip builds practical lower-body power, total-body coordination, and safe object-handling technique.

How To Do The Tire Flip Exercise

‘- Stand with feet about shoulder-width, shins close to the tire, toes slightly out.
– Hinge and squat down with a neutral spine, chest up, and braced abdomen.
– Place fingers under the tread with palms against the sidewall; hands just outside shoulder width.
– Set shoulders down and back; keep elbows straight to avoid “curling” the tire.
– Inhale to brace; drive through the midfoot/heels, extending hips and knees together to lift.
– Keep the tire close to your body; walk your feet in as it rises to reduce leverage on the back.
– When the tire reaches roughly mid‑thigh to chest height and begins to tip, switch to a push.
– Reposition one or both hands to the front face of the tire, step through, and drive it over with hips, chest, and shoulders.
– Extend your arms to finish the shove; release and step back so the tire lands clear of your feet.
– Reset your stance and grip before each subsequent flip; never place fingers beneath a falling tire.
– Common faults to avoid: rounding the lower back, initiating with the arms, letting the tire drift away, or holding your breath too long.
